How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cache Junction?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cache Junction Studio Apartments | $1,186 | $1,125 | $1,349 |
Cache Junction 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,385 | $795 | $1,892 |
Cache Junction 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,591 | $895 | $2,294 |
Cache Junction 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,728 | $500 | $3,110 |
Cache Junction 4 Bedroom Apartments | $695 | $695 | $695 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cache Junction
How much are Studio apartments in Cache Junction?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Cache Junction with rent ranges from $1,125 to $1,349 with an average price of $1,186.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cache Junction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cache Junction ranges from $795 to $1,892 with an average monthly rent of $1,385.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cache Junction c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cache Junction range from $895 to $2,294.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,591.
How expensive are Cache Junction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Cache Junction on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$500 to $3,110 - averaging $1,728 for the location.
